you'll taste caramel before milk chocolate. this is primary (our seasonal blend), a colombia + peru + honduras + nicaragua from color coffee roasters.
primary tastes of caramel, milk chocolate, and dark chocolate, giving it a sweet, cocoa-forward cup with a creamy, approachable character.
the blend combines coffees from colombia (huila), peru, honduras, and nicaragua, though specific processing details such as washed or natural have not been provided for this blend.
no single brew method is specified, but its chocolate and caramel profile works well across both espresso and filter methods, with or without milk.
